The cameras are switched by PLC commands over the powerline. So if the CM15A can still control other modules and AHP is running normally, then it probably isn't the CM15A, other than perhaps the PLC camera ON command from the CM15A isn't getting to the camera power supplies. Do you had a Scan Pad remote? does it switch cameras? You have not changed unit codes on the camera power supplies have you, they must be addressed in groups of four (1,2,3,4 or 5,6,7,8...etc). When one camera in the group is sent an ON command the remaining three in the group automatically turn OFF.

You shouldn't have to uninstall. The newer versions of AHP added support for the newer "SoftStart" versions of the lamp modules and wall switches. Unfortunately, X10 didn't change the model numbers, which has led to a lot of confusion and frustration on the part of their customers.
When AHP was updated to support the SoftStart modules, they added a new category, called "Old Lamps - no SoftStart". The modules in there are the "older" ones, the ones without the SoftStart feature.
Try re-defining your older lamp modules and wall switches using the ones in that category, and see what happens.
